Confused benzo for sleep

My sleep has deteriorated significantly since menopause and some severe stressors that all happened close together. I have tried everything natural and still my sleep has gotten worse. I get drowsy, fall asleep and then suddenly am awake again. Over and over. Docs say this is related to anxiety, which I am sometimes aware of but not usually. I tried trazodone 25mg at bedtime. It worked for a few months. Now it no longer works. Hypnotics don't work. In the past month I have taken xanax at bedtime more nights than not. If I don't take it I am lucky to get 2 hours of sleep. My primary and my sleep doc think I should just take the xanax every night. I see a psych nurse who wants to switch me to klonopin every night. I have never taken anything like this before and it scares me. But the lack of sleep is unbearable. Has anyone successfully taken a benzo for sleep for more than a few weeks or months? I am taking .5 mg of the xanax and 25 mg of trazodone about an hour before bed and then going to bed when I am very sleepy. Either the xanax has made me forget or I am not startling awake when I do that. My sleep doc also tried vicodin for my restless leg syndrome but I cannot take it with the xanax and I cannot sleep without the xanax, so I have given up on that.
